Blk 15 Beach Rd is an HDB block in Kallang/Whampoa (completed in 1974, 20 storeys, 76 units). As of Jul 2026, its median resale price over the last 24 months is $660,000, from 2 sales. 67 resale transactions have been recorded here since 1990.

On price per square metre, this block is cheaper than 24% of Kallang/Whampoa blocks with recent sales.
For a typical 4-room flat here, our price model estimates $509,931–$570,431 (central estimate $540,181). Recent sales — median $584,612 — sit above that range. The model explains 94% of resale prices with a typical error of ±6%. Indicative only — not an official valuation.
